Выборка по дате

A_525

Добрый день! Для того, что бы выбрать необходимую мне дату пишу условие "where date = '31-DEC-2009'" результат - "31.12.2009", при попытке выбрать через услови "where date = '31.12.2009'" - выдаёт ошибку "ORA-01843: not a valid month", при этом "галачка" на "Date fields to_char" НЕ стоит и в "Date/Time" выбрано Windows format. Поскажите, что нужно сделать чтобы я мог вводить '31.12.2009' - и не было ошибки.
3 ответа

A_525

Напишите так
WHERE DATE = to_date( '09.12.2009', 'dd.mm.yyyy')
Вот статья про использование типа date - файл zipps А как файл zip загрузить на форум? Куда надо ткнуть мышкой?


A_525

A_525, по умолчанию формат даты через тире, а не точкуLaba, для этого необходимо перейти в расширенный режим, кнопка справа от быстрого ответа и там выбрать вложения


A_525

Laba, спасбо за фаил! полезная информация! помогло